Job Summary

The primary purpose of the staff pharmacist is to train, develop, and monitor pharmacy technicians while ensuring pharmaceutical products are delivered with exceptional accuracy and quality. A thorough understanding of USP 795, 797 and 800 is essential when determining the quality of pharmacy products. Effective leadership and department work-flow management optimize technician productivity.

Job Activities and Responsibilities: The responsibilities listed below are subject to change.

  • Directs and oversees the operations of pharmacy and pharmacy technicians in their applicable department
  • Train, develop, and monitor staff in specific department
  • Understand compounding techniques outlined in USP 795, 797 and 800
  • Processing of prescriptions using pharmacy software
  • Consultation with patients and providers regarding our compounded medications as well as traditional medications.
  • Inventory control and supply management equip technicians to perform their tasks without interruption.
  • Other duties as designated
  • Staff pharmacists report directly to the Pharmacist in Charge.

Qualifications:

  • Licensed as a Pharmacist in Ohio or eligible for such licensure. Willingness to obtain Pharmacist licensure in other states (company will pay reciprocity expenses.) Residence within a reasonable commute of Beachwood, Ohio or willingness to relocate to the greater Cleveland area.
  • Leadership skill and ability to manage staff effectively and efficiently
  • Excellent customer services skills and a genuine desire to serve clients, organization and strong phone skills
  • Organized, high-integrity, attention to detail, dependable, quality focus, empathetic, good listener/communicator
  • Energetic, highly motivated, team player with strong personal and communication skills; discretion and confidentiality essential as position deals with highly sensitive and private data
  • Overseeing the compounding preparations of acceptable quality, strength, and purity with appropriate packaging and labeling regarding good pharmacy practices, state regulations, PCAB standards, and current scientific applications (training provided).
  • Other duties, responsibilities and qualifications may be required and/or assigned as necessary.

Physical Requirements:

  • Proficient in using a computer and related equipment, including printers and fax machines.
  • Ability to sit or stand for extended periods.
  • Effective communication skills via telephone and email.
  • Capable of lifting up to 40 pounds as needed.
  • 20/20 vision (with or without corrective aids) required for visual inspection of drug products, in accordance with legal requirements

Benefits:

  • Health care insurance (medical, dental, vision)
  • Life Insurance
  • Supplemental Insurance
  • PTO
  • 401K matching
  • Sick leave
